How to Efficiently Manage Multiple Google Tag Manager Containers Across Distributor Websites for Consistent Tracking and Fast Updates

Managing multiple Google Tag Manager (GTM) containers across different distributor websites can be complex, especially when you need consistent tracking and the ability to deploy quick updates at scale. To streamline this process, implement a structured approach combining container architecture design, automation, governance, and monitoring. This guide provides actionable strategies to help you efficiently oversee multiple GTM containers, ensuring data consistency, rapid deployment, and reduced errors.


1. Adopt a Hybrid Container Architecture to Balance Consistency and Flexibility

Decide between using a single GTM container for all distributor sites or separate containers for each. The optimal choice often lies in a hybrid model:

  • Master Container: Houses common tags, variables, and triggers (e.g., Google Analytics 4, Google Ads, Facebook Pixel), ensuring consistent tracking across all distributors.
  • Site-Specific Containers: Extend the master container to include distributor-unique tags and configurations tailored to individual marketing strategies or product lines.

This separation enables unified reporting alongside the flexibility to customize, reducing redundancy and minimizing the risk of global changes inadvertently affecting unrelated sites.

2. Standardize Naming Conventions and Data Layer Schemas Across All Containers

Consistency starts with standardized naming and data layers:

  • Establish clear naming conventions for tags, triggers, and variables (e.g., GA4 - Purchase Event, Trigger - Form Submission).
  • Implement a common data layer schema across all distributor sites to capture key dimensions like user info, product details, and transaction data.

Document your naming standards and data layer structures comprehensively for distributor teams to follow, ensuring accuracy and easing troubleshooting.

3. Use GTM Workspaces and Environments to Enable Safe, Rapid Updates

GTM's built-in workspaces and environments help maintain version control and support parallel development:

  • Create multiple workspaces for features like testing or bug fixes to avoid conflicts.
  • Set up separate environments (development, QA, production) to preview changes without impacting live data or users.

Assign environment-specific variables, such as test Google Analytics IDs, to keep test data isolated.

4. Automate Bulk Container Management with the Google Tag Manager API

Manual updates across multiple containers quickly become error-prone and time-consuming. Leverage the GTM API to:

  • Automate container creation using templates.
  • Deploy tag, trigger, and variable updates simultaneously across containers.
  • Retrieve container versions and audit change histories programmatically.

Automation drastically reduces human error, accelerates deployment, and ensures all distributor sites receive consistent updates promptly.

5. Implement a Governance Framework with Strict Roles, Permissions, and Approval Processes

Maintain control by enforcing a structured governance model:

  • Use Role-Based Access Control (RBAC) to separate permissions between marketing teams, web developers, and admins.
  • Require multi-step approval workflows to review and QA tag changes before publishing.
  • Keep detailed documentation for each tag or update to support auditability.

This governance minimizes accidental errors and enforces accountability.

7. Foster Clear Communication and Training for Distributor Teams

Efficient multi-container management requires close collaboration:

  • Use dedicated communication channels (e.g., Slack, Microsoft Teams) for GTM updates.
  • Share documentation, playbooks, and checklists for tag previews and publishing.
  • Conduct regular training sessions on GTM best practices, including debugging with the GTM preview and debug mode.

Empowered distributor teams can autonomously handle common updates, reducing bottlenecks.


8. Regularly Audit and Optimize Containers for Performance and Relevance

Schedule periodic reviews to:

  • Remove outdated or unused tags and triggers to reduce clutter.
  • Optimize tag load sequences and firing rules to improve page speed.
  • Validate data layer implementations and tag firing accuracy.

Use tools like Google Tag Assistant and GA Debugger to assist audits.


9. Leverage Custom and Community Tag Templates for Efficiency

Build or adopt custom GTM templates to streamline common tracking needs across distributors:

  • Create reusable templates for specialized tags.
  • Use community templates vetted by Google to expand capabilities safely.

10. Build Error Logging and Debugging Mechanisms into Container Design

Embed robust error tracking within your containers:

  • Use fallback tags or error logging pixels to capture failed tag executions.
  • Integrate debug tools and send errors to centralized logging platforms.

Proactive error detection prevents data loss and maintains data quality at scale.
